CHARLES HODGE (1797–1878) was a professor of biblical literature and theology at Princeton for over fifty years. Hodge also edited thePrinceton Review for forty-six years, in which he particularly championed divine sovereignty in salvation and the infallibility of the Bible. He is especially well-known for his commentaries on Romans, Ephesians, and 1 and 2 Corinthians.
